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Coordinate execution of approved Retail Success Partner Plans in collaboration with the Retail Success Manager
  • Schedule vendor days, in-person staff educations, retailer touchpoints, and approved activations
  • Support execution of vendor days, store visits, and staff educations as needed
  • Ensure merchandising, physical and digital displays, and Brand Kits are properly set up and maintained in retail locations
  • Serve as field coverage support during high-volume periods, launches, or team bandwidth gaps
  • Manage swag inventory, assemble Brand Kits + Gifting, and Retail Success asset fulfillment
  • Maintain organized documentation for Retail Success programs, assets, and timelines
  • Update Retail Success trackers, dashboards, and weekly reporting
  • Track vendor days, staff educations, spiffs, Brand Kit placements, and retailer touchpoints
  • Capture and consolidate retailer feedback, sales insights, and competitive observations

Requirements

  • 2+ years of experience in retail operations, field marketing, coordination, or related roles
  • Comfortable working both in the field and in an operational support capacity
  • Highly organized with strong attention to detail and follow-through
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to work evenings and weekends for events and vendor days
  • Proficiency with Google Workspace, Slack, Asana, and reporting tools
  • Basic experience capturing photo/video content for social or marketing use
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ment
  • Experience in cannabis, retail, or CPG environments preferred
  • Valid driver’s license and ability to travel as needed
